The UCC28180DR operates based on the voltage mode control technique. It compares the feedback voltage from the output with a reference voltage and adjusts the duty cycle of the PWM signal accordingly. This control mechanism ensures precise regulation of the output voltage and current.
During operation, the error amplifier compares the feedback voltage with the reference voltage and generates an error signal. This signal is then fed into the PWM comparator, which compares it with a sawtooth waveform generated by the oscillator. The resulting PWM signal controls the power switch, adjusting the duty cycle to maintain the desired output voltage.
